From Bussy-Saint-Georges to Compans by RER and train
To get from Bussy-Saint-Georges to Compans in Paris, you’ll need to take 2 RER lines and one train line: take the A RER from Bussy-Saint-Georges station to Châtelet - Les Halles station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the B RER and finally take the K train from Gare du Nord station to Compans station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 22 min.
